New Toyota Supra set to launch at North American International Auto Show

Finally, we know when we will be seeing for the first time the brand-new Toyota Supra. That will happen at the North American International Auto Show in Detroit next January if we are to believe Toyota of Germany.

The news came via Toyota Deutschland’s Facebook page. Germans interested in the Supra can also put their names down on a list in order to get their hands on the first units headed to Germany.

The Supra is definitely real, but it’s reassuring to know we have an actually unveiling to look forward to. Somehow, that camouflaged car we’ve seen running around everywhere just wasn’t enough to do away with any scepticism.

We have, after all, been waiting for the production Supra ever since we saw the FT-1 Concept four years ago in Detroit.
